The realization of the project “Right to Work for Everyone” began on April 1st, 2019 in the Mitrovica region. The project was financed by the Swedish International Development Cooperation Agency and supported by the Danish Refugee Council. Non-governmental organization Center for Lifelong Learning Lighthouse is implementing the project. The goal of the project “Right to Work for Everyone” is to provide equal opportunities for education and employment for members of marginalized social groups living in the Mitrovica region. The realization of the project will contribute to the empowerment of Roma population as well as members of other marginalized groups in this area.

Marginalized categories of citizens do not have equal opportunities for development and progress in society. As a result most of the Roma people are at a low educational level. This is characterized by long-term exclusion from the labor market. Roma people represent a category with the highest risk of social exclusion. Additional educational programs and specialized trainings for marginalized social groups in this region are organized occasionally and do not provide continuous education and training for work.

Specialized Courses

During the lifetime of the project, “Right to Work for Everyone”, the Center for Lifelong Learning Lighthouse will organize the following specialized courses: a course of woodworking and plastic processing that includes theoretical and practical part; marketing and accounting course; course for writing CV and motivation letters; life skills training that includes English language course and computer training. By the end of the project, twenty participants will finish the course of wood and plastic processing. Twenty other participants will  complete the  marketing and accounting course. All participants of the two courses will be able to attend life skills training that will include an English language course and computer training. By the end of the program, students will learn how to write a CV and motivation letter. 

Upon completion of the program, participants will have the opportunity to meet potential employers and submit their work biographies. Non-governmental organization Center for Lifelong Learning Lighthouse will organize meeting with employers at the premises of the organization in Mitrovica.

The courses and trainings will be organized in Mitrovica, in the premises of the Center for Lifelong Learning Lighthouse. The practical part of the training will be organized in the workshop of Social Enterprise “Veza”
